Waheeda Saib, a Chartered Accountant with over 20 years’ experience, began her career with the Big Four before joining the Auditor-General of South Africa. She specializes in risk assessment, internal control evaluation, financial and asset management under IFRS and GRAP, and compliance assessments including PFMA, MFMA, and Supply Chain Management. Waheeda’s expertise spans both public and private sectors, with a focus on enhancing financial reporting and legislative compliance..

Chief Financial Officer:
Waheeda Saib

Jarrod graduated with an MSc from the University of Cape Town and became an Industrial Symbiosis practitioner for the Western Cape Industrial Symbiosis Programme at GreenCape. He has contributed to creating an investment-friendly ecosystem in the Western Cape and South Africa, enhancing their value proposition for green economy investments. His industry exposure has made him an expert in green technology, understanding various technologies, their impacts, and the business cases for successful global deployment.

Executive Business Development:
Jarrod Lyons

Joyce Modipa, a civil engineer and registered Professional Construction Project Manager (PrCPM), has 19 years of experience in public-funded projects. With a Master’s in Development Finance, she excels in program and project management across various sectors. As Programme Manager for ASIDI, she led infrastructure delivery. Joyce is skilled in analytical problem-solving and managing multi-disciplinary teams, recognized for her excellence in sustainable infrastructure planning and development finance.

Executive Infrastructure:
Joyce Modipa
